Think of these labels as nutrition facts for power devices. But instead of calories, we're talking kilowatt-hours. Let's break down the key components:
Take Tesla's Powerwall label – it clearly states 13.5 kWh capacity with 100% depth of discharge. But here's the kicker: that 10-year warranty only applies if you follow the temperature guidelines listed in... you guessed it, the label's fine print.
